Transaction efdbd94e22ce90708d6a9e97957e37c82306412b78ff3816b00962d5ce475601
1 Input
1 Output
-
efdbd94e22ce90708d6a9e97957e37c82306412b78ff3816b00962d5ce475601:0
- value
- 138047
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a2d100582f775ffb0464b9fd2ed7b49da8a6865c OP_EQUAL
- address
- 3GXumHgHQwCiLUh4fMPk4LpjFmDVsVA4Gr